It was originally a Sega Space Firebird mini, and it still is
externally. The only external difference is that it has a new joystick
(the Happs Universal joystick, which can be switched between 8-way and
true 4-way mode).
Internally it has a 14" VGA monitor (in place of the original 14" CGA
one). This has been decased and looks great. This isn't like a lot of
other Mame cabinets where you can tell it has a PC monitor, you can't.
The computer is running caseless (with all components mounted on the
back door, which can be removed for easy service). It is an Athlon 650
with 128 RAM (I THINK it has a Voodoo3 video card, but I can't
remember anymore, I can check if anyone actually cares). I seem to recall that the hard drive was a lot larger than it needs to be as well (I think it was like a 30 gig, once again I can check if this actually matters, which it shouldn't as this is a complete unit that you will not need to futz around with).
It is running the gamelauncher frontend. You just pick the game off
the menu and go. You can insert credits by pressing the left coin
return switch and exit the game by pressing the right one. There is
also a power button for the PC mounted on the back door for easy
powerup.
The cabinet itself is in great overall shape. It is a very small mini
(much smaller than most). The marquee and bezel are in terrific
condition and the control panel overlay is decent looking (not
perfect, but more than presentable). The cabinet design is plywood with white laminate.
It currently has all the 8-way vertical Mame titles installed, but I
can also add the 4-way ones if the buyer wants them.
